    Jeju Teddy Bear Museum

    제주 테디베어뮤지엄

    The 'teddy bear' doll commonly possessed by Western children feels more like a family member than a simple toy. Located within the Jungmun Tourist Complex on Jeju Island, a prime tourist destination in Korea, the Teddy Bear Museum opened in April 2001 and has established itself as a theme park for families and couples to enjoy together. Although teddy bear museums are already well known in places like the UK, Japan, and the US, it is an exotic and unique attraction in Korea. Boasting the world's largest scale for a teddy bear museum (total land area of 13,553㎡, total floor area of 4,297㎡), it offers a distinctive and enjoyable travel experience to visitors in Jeju.More

    Jungmun Tourist Complex

    중문관광단지

    Seogwipo is regarded as a blessed cultural tourism destination, endowed with diverse, outstanding natural scenery and a mild southern climate. In particular, the designation of the Jungmun-dong area as an international tourist complex in 1971 allowed it to develop into an international tourism city. As Korea's largest comprehensive tourist complex, Jungmun Tourist Complex is a large-scale total resort situated on the coast of Jungmun-dong at the western end of Seogwipo. Within the already developed central area spanning 2.25 million square meters, various tourist facilities are provided—including seven top-class accommodations, Pacific Land, Yeomiji Botanical Garden, a golf course, Seonimgyo Bridge, Cheonjeyeon Falls, and Jungmun Beach—welcoming many domestic and international tourists.More

    Jungmun Saekdal Beach

    중문·색달 해변

    Featuring a sandy shore approximately 560 meters long, 50 meters wide, with an average slope of 5 degrees and water depth of 1.2 meters, Jungmun Beach is distinctive for its bow-curved expanse and its four-colored sand called "Jinmosal" (black, white, red, and gray). The beautiful scenery created by the harmony between this Jinmosal sand and Jeju's characteristic black basalt makes it a frequent filming location for movies and dramas. Along the coastal cliff standing like a folding screen to the right of the beach, there is a natural cave about 15 meters long. In addition, many rare plants grow wild along this coastal cliff, allowing visitors to enjoy ecotourism as well. More
